No fuel going to carburetor ??? Your vehicle should have fuel injection ,not a carburetor . Is the SECURITY light lit on the instrument cluster ? Anti-theft system will keep fuel injectors from firing , or if there isn't any spark at the spark plugs the crankshaft position sensor could be bad . The PCM - engine computer will energize the fuel pump relay for two seconds to prim the fuel lines an the fuel rail for the injectors . After that it won't unless the engine is cranking over , an the PCM see's an input from the crankshaft position sensor . Your best , take it to a qualified repair shop.

SOURCE: 96 Oldsmobile Bravada 4.3 liter

The fuel pressure regulator is located under the intake plenum attached to the six in one fuel injector.They leak quite often causing hard start conditions.The injector is also known as a spider injector which will come with the regulator .

I think the fuel pump is shot in a 2000 oldsmobile bravada the vehicle turns over and has good battery power however is acting like it is getting no fuel. how do I replace it. or is there something else...

I would start by spraying starting fluid in the air filter. If it starts then you will know for sure it is a fuel problem. A way you can check the fuel pump is take off the gas cap. Have someone listen where the cap was. Turn the key to the on position and the person listening should hear the fuel pump run for about 5 seconds. If it doesn't run it could be the fuel pump relay which is under the hood on the driver side. You can swap it for the one next to it temporarily. But 98% of the time it is the fuel pump. You have to drop the fuel tank. It is held up by 2 straps. And the fuel pump is in the top of the tank. You have to turn a retainer ring half a turn to get the pump out. Be sure to get the filter on the new one really good. It will ruin the new pump the first time you start the car. It will **** up dirt off of the bottom of the tank.

2000 Oldsmobile Bravada

Please stop using the starting fluid, it is terrible for your engine- use choke cleaner if you need to do this in the future again. you can run it on choke cleaner indefinately if needed.
It sounds like your fuel pump quit on ya. When you turn the key to the "run" position do you hear the pump run in the tank for 3-5 seconds? you should. The fuel pump is in the gas tank and the tank has to be removed to acess it.
you can remove the coil wire from the coil and check to see if the coil is firing a spark. crank the engine with the wire off. make sure there is no starting fluid or choke cleaner fumes around before you do this-k? Carefull not to let it shock you. if it is sparking then you should check the fuel pressure. it should be 60psi while cranking the engine. you will need a fuel pressure guage to do this.
